Define Extension In Pcr . polymerase chain reaction (pcr) is a technique that has revolutionized the world of molecular biology and beyond. overlap extension pcr, also known as splicing by overlap extension, is a versatile technique that is commonly used to fuse. pcr extension is an essential step in the pcr process, during which the dna polymerase enzyme extends the primers. In the third step in the process, the dna polymerase replicates dna by extension from the 3’ end of the primer, making a new dna strand. the last of 3 basic pcr steps is called extension or elongation step. The reaction is then heated to 72° c, the optimal temperature for dna polymerase to act.
